Where is the Hapes family from?

You can see how Hapes families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Hapes family name was found in the USA, and the UK between 1880 and 1920. The most Hapes families were found in USA in 1880. In 1891 there were 5 Hapes families living in Durham. This was 100% of all the recorded Hapes's in United Kingdom. Durham had the highest population of Hapes families in 1891.

What did your Hapes 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Stenographer were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Hapes. 78% of Hapes men worked as a Laborer and 100% of Hapes women worked as a Stenographer.

What is the average Hapes lifespan?

Between 1964 and 2004, in the United States, Hapes life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1998, and highest in 1996. The average life expectancy for Hapes in 1964 was 77, and 82 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Hapes 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
